Abstract
Contrast-enhanced ultrasound (CEUS) is a radiation-free, safe, and in specific clinical settings, highly sensitive imaging modality. Over the recent decades, there is cumulating experience and a large volume of published safety and efficacy data on pediatric CEUS applications. Many of these applications have been directly translated from adults, while others are unique to the pediatric population. The most frequently reported intravenous abdominal applications of CEUS in children are the characterization of focal liver lesions, monitoring of solid abdominal tumor response to treatment, and the evaluation of intra-abdominal parenchymal injuries in selected cases of blunt abdominal trauma. The intravesical CEUS application, namely contrast-enhanced voiding urosonography (ceVUS), is a well-established, pediatric-specific imaging technique entailing the intravesical administration of ultrasound contrast agents for detection and grading of vesicoureteral reflux. In Europe, all pediatric CEUS applications remain off-label. In 2016, the United States Food and Drug Administration (FDA) approved the most commonly used worldwide second-generation ultrasound contrast SonoVue®/Lumason® for pediatric liver and intravesical applications, giving new impetus to pediatric CEUS worldwide.

Tang X, Dong L, Tan M, Yi P, Yang F, Hao Q. Long-Term Influence of C1-C2 Pedicle Screw Fixation on Occipitoatlantal Angle and Subaxial Cervical Spine in the Pediatric Population. Pediatr Neurosurg 2018. [PMID: 29514167 DOI: 10.1159/000481784] [Citation(s) in RCA: 5] [Impact Index Per Article: 0.8]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 12/31/2022]
Abstract
OBJECTIVE The goal of this study was to evaluate the impact of C1-C2 pedicle screw fixation on the occipitoatlantal angle and subaxial cervical spine for a pediatric population, and the clinical efficacy and adjacent-segment degeneration after C1-C2 pedicle screw fixation with a minimum of 2 years of follow-up. METHODS Twenty-two pediatric patients with atlantoaxial dislocation who were enrolled in this study underwent atlantoaxial pedicle screw fixation. The correlation between C0-C1, C2-C7, and C1-C2 pre- and postoperative sagittal angles was assessed using plain radiographs, and adjacent-segment degeneration (ASD) and JOA scores (Japanese Orthopaedic Association scores) were evaluated after atlantoaxial pedicle screw fixation. RESULTS The C1-C2 angle increased from 16.1 ± 13.37 to 28.1 ± 5.1° (p < 0.01). The pre- and postoperative C1-C2 angles were negatively correlated with the pre- and postoperative C0-C1 and C2-C7 angles, respectively. In accordance with the optimal atlantoaxial fusion angle (25-30°) obtained from the literature, postoperative JOA scores were greater in the groups with angles of more than 30° and less than 25°, although the difference in ASD was not statistically significant. Postoperative JOA scores were not relevant to the postoperative C1-C2 angle; however, there was a positive correlation between JOA improvement rate and the change of the C1-C2 angle postoperatively. CONCLUSION Atlantoaxial pedicle screw fixation can be used easily to reduce atlantoaxial dislocation in the pediatric population; however, outside the range of the optimal atlantoaxial fusion angle it can change the occipitoatlantal angle and subaxial alignment, which induces ASD and influences the clinical efficacy. It is necessary to achieve an optimal atlantoaxial angle when using atlantoaxial pedicle screw fixation.

Saha L, Kaur S, Khosla P, Kumari S, Rani A. Pharmacoeconomic Analysis of Drugs Used in the Treatment of Pneumonia in Paediatric Population in a Tertiary Care Hospital in India-A Cost-of-Illness Study. Med Sci (Basel) 2017; 5:E33. Abstract
AIMS AND OBJECTIVES The cost of antibiotic therapy for the treatment of pneumonia in the inpatient paediatric population can have a major impact on the healthcare expenditure. We planned to assess the direct and indirect costs of diagnosis and medical treatment of paediatric patients with community acquired pneumonia who are hospitalized in a tertiary care hospital in India. METHODS 125 children with a diagnosis of pneumonia who were admitted to the inpatient department of a paediatric hospital receiving antibiotic treatment were observed. Data on clinical presentation and resources consumed were collected and the costs of pneumonia treatment were calculated. Descriptive statistics (mean ± standard deviation (SD)) were used to evaluate data regarding demographics, drugs prescribed and cost (direct and indirect cost). Multivariate regression analysis was used to find out predictors of direct and indirect cost. RESULTS Among all pneumonia admissions, mild-to-moderate pneumonia constitutes 76.8%, and 23.2% children were admitted with severe pneumonia; 105 children out of 125 (84%) were suffering from associated disorders along with pneumonia. The majority of antibiotics prescribed belonged to beta lactams (52%) followed by aminoglycosides (19%), macrolides (13%) and peptides (11%). Parenteral routes of administration were used in a majority of patients as compared to oral. The average cost per patient in management of pneumonia was 12245 ± 593 INR ($187.34 ± 9.07).

Shkalim Zemer V, Toledano H, Kornreich L, Freud E, Atar E, Avigad S, Feinberg-Gorenshtein G, Fichman S, Issakov J, Dujovny T, Yaniv I, Ash S. Sporadic desmoid tumors in the pediatric population: A single center experience and review of the literature. J Pediatr Surg 2017; 52:1637-1641. Abstract
BACKGROUND/PURPOSE We present our long experience with desmoid tumors in children. METHODS Data were retrospectively collected from 17 children/adolescents treated for sporadic desmoid tumors at a tertiary pediatric hospital in 1988-2016. There were 10 girls and 7 boys aged 1-17years. Tumor sites included head and neck, trunk, extremity, and groin. Eight patients underwent radical resection, with complete remission in 7 and local relapse in one which was treated with chemotherapy. Four patients underwent incomplete surgical resection, three with adjuvant chemotherapy. Five patients underwent biopsy only and chemotherapy. Two of the 9 chemotherapy-treated patients also had intraarterial chemoembolization. Chemotherapy usually consisted of vincristine and actinomycin-D with or without cyclophosphamide or low-dose vinblastine and methotrexate. Two patients also received tamoxifen. RESULTS After a median follow-up of 3.3years, 10 patients were alive in complete remission, 5 had stable disease, and 2 had reduced tumor size. Five-year overall survival was 100%, and event-free survival, 87.5%. Ten were screened for CTNNB1 mutations. CTNNB1 gene sequencing yielded mutations in 5/10 samples tested: 3 T41A, 2 S45F. There was no association of CTNNB1 mutation with clinical outcome or prognosis. CONCLUSION Pediatric desmoid tumors are rare, with variable biologic behavior and morbidity. Treatment requires a multidisciplinary approach. LEVEL OF EVIDENCE LEVEL IV, treatment study.

Abstract
The diagnosis of epilepsy in children is known to impact the trajectory of their health-related quality of life (HRQOL) over time. However, there is limited knowledge about variations in longitudinal trajectories across multiple domains of HRQOL. This study aims to characterize the heterogeneity in HRQOL trajectories across multiple HRQOL domains and to evaluate predictors of differences among the identified trajectory groups in children with new-onset epilepsy. Data were obtained from the Health Related Quality of Life in Children with Epilepsy Study (HERQULES), a prospective multi-center study of 373 children newly diagnosed with new-onset epilepsy who were followed up over 2years. Child HRQOL and family factors were reported by parents, and clinical characteristics were reported by neurologists. Group-based multi-trajectory modeling was adopted to characterize longitudinal trajectories of HRQOL as measured by the individual domains of cognitive, emotional, physical, and social functioning in the 55-item Quality of Life in Childhood Epilepsy Questionnaire (QOLCE-55). Multinomial logistic regression was used to assess potential factors that explain differences among the identified latent trajectory groups. Three distinct HRQOL trajectory subgroups were identified in children with new-onset epilepsy based on HRQOL scores: "High" (44.7%), "Intermediate" (37.0%), and "Low" (18.3%). While most trajectory groups exhibited increasing scores over time on physical and social domains, both flat and declining trajectories were noted on emotional and cognitive domains. Less severe epilepsy, an absence of cognitive and behavioral problems, lower parental depression scores, better family functioning, and fewer family demands were associated with a "Higher" or "Intermediate" HRQOL trajectory. The course of HRQOL over time in children with new-onset epilepsy appears to follow one of three different trajectories. Addressing the clinical and psychosocial determinants identified for each pattern can help clinicians provide more targeted care to these children and their families.

Abstract
Weight is a covariate representative of body size and is known to influence drug disposition. Recently, with increased use of allometric scaling, this variable has become more significant in accounting for variability in pharmacokinetic parameters. In adults, weight can be considered as a time invariant covariate because physical development is complete. As a result, when weight is missing in data, the typical or median value (say, 70 kg) could be imputed. On the contrary, weight continuously changes with age in the pediatric population. In this case, it is more appropriate to consider different median weight for each age group. We constructed a prediction model for weight using postmenstrual age (PMA) with the data consisting of 83,014 Korean pediatric patients. Weight, PMA, and gender information were collected from electronic medical records. Sigmoid models multiplied by exponential or logistic function were tested for basic model structure. Covariate effects on model parameters were then investigated using selection criteria of p < 0.001. All analyses were performed using NONMEM 7.3.0 and R3.2.0. The sigmoid model multiplied by logistic function best described the data and there was a significant difference between boys and girls in model parameters. It is expected that the results obtained in this work can be used for imputation of missing weights in pediatrics when PMA is available. In addition, the developed model can be used for clinical studies in children under 12 years old whose weight change rapidly with age and for model building in dealing with time varying body weight as a covariate.

Abstract
AIMS To estimate the social-economic costs of Type 1 Diabetes Mellitus (T1DM) in patients aged 0-17years in Spain from a social perspective. METHODS We conducted a cross-sectional observational study in 2014 of 275 T1DM pediatric outpatients distributed across 12 public health centers in Spain. Data on demographic and clinical characteristics, healthcare utilization and informal care were collected from medical records and questionnaires completed by clinicians and patients' caregivers. RESULTS A valid sample of 249 individuals was analyzed. The average annual cost for a T1DM patient was €27,274. Direct healthcare costs were €4070 and direct non-healthcare cost were €23,204. Informal (familial) care represented 83% of total cost, followed by medical material (8%), outpatient and primary care visits (3.1%) and insulin (2.1%). Direct healthcare cost per patient statistically differed by glycated haemoglobin (HbA1c) level [mean cost €4704 in HbA1c ≥7.5% (≥58mmol/mol) group vs. €3616 in HbA1c<7.5% (<58mmol/mol) group)]; and by the presence or absence of complications and comorbidities (mean cost €5713 in group with complications or comorbidities vs. €3636 in group without complications or comorbidities). CONCLUSIONS T1DM amongst pediatric patients incurs in considerable societal costs. Informal care represents the largest cost category.

Abstract
This study evaluated the necessity of examining the upper airway in children with nocturnal enuresis. 225 children (aged 5-16 years), who were referred from the urology outpatient clinic between May 2015 and May 2016 and who had completed toilet training, were included in this study. Participants were separated into monosymptomatic nocturnal enuresis (MNE) (group 1) and without MNE (group 2) groups. Tonsil hypertrophy, adenoid vegetation, septal deviation, turbinate hypertrophy, allergic rhinitis, upper airway obstruction, and snoring etiology were assessed. In total, 112 children with MNE (group 1) participated in addition to 113 children selected randomly without MNE (group 2). Adenoid score (p = 0.016), septal deviation (p = 0.017), and snoring (p = 0.007) were significantly different between the groups. No differences in tonsil score (p = 0.618), turbinate hypertrophy (p = 0.424), and allergic rhinitis (p = 0.544) were detected between the groups. Possible causes of upper airway obstruction and snoring which is a symptom of obstructive sleep-disordered breathing in the pediatric population, including adenoid hypertrophy and septal deviation, should be considered as possible etiological factors in children with MNE.

Abstract
Animal models indicate that endocrine disrupting chemicals (EDCs) affect circulating lipid concentrations by interfering with hepatic fatty acid oxidation. Little is known of the relationship between EDC exposure and lipid profile in humans. We measured bisphenol A (BPA) and 9 phthalate metabolites in maternal urine collected at up to three time points during pregnancy as a measure of in utero exposure, and in the child's urine at 8-14 years as a measure of concurrent, peripubertal exposure among 248 participants of a Mexico City pre-birth cohort. We used linear regression to examine relations of BPA and phthalate exposure with peripubertal serum lipids, while also adjusting for child age, sex, and specific gravity. While in utero EDC exposure was not associated with lipid profile, higher concurrent levels of mono-3-carboxypropyl phthalate (MCPP), monoethyl phthalate (MEP), and dibutyl phthalate metabolites (DBP) corresponded with lower total cholesterol and low-density lipoprotein (LDL-C) in boys; e.g., an interquartile range increment in MCPP corresponded with 7.4% (2.0%, 12.8%) lower total cholesterol and 12.7% (3.8%, 21.6%) lower LDL-C. In girls, higher urinary di-2-ethylhexyl phthalate metabolites (ΣDEHP) correlated with lower LDL-C (-7.9% [-15.4%, -0.4%]). Additional longitudinal research is needed to determine whether these associations persist beyond adolescence.

Abstract
The study objective was to examine whether meeting the new Canadian 24-hour movement guidelines was associated with health indicators in a representative sample of Canadian children and youth. Cross-sectional findings are based on 4157 (1239 fasting subsample) children and youth aged 6-17years from cycles 1-3 of the Canadian Health Measures Survey (CHMS). Sleep and screen time were subjectively measured while moderate- to vigorous-intensity physical activity (MVPA) was accelerometer-determined. Health indicators in the full sample (body mass index (BMI) z-scores, waist circumference, blood pressure, behavioral strengths and difficulties score (lower=better), and aerobic fitness) and fasting subsample (triglycerides, high-density lipoprotein (HDL)-cholesterol, C-reactive protein, and insulin) were measured. Meeting the overall guidelines was defined as: 9-11 hour/night (5-13years) or 8-10 hour/day (14-17years) of sleep, ≤2 hour/day of screen time, and ≥60 minute/day of MVPA. Compared to meeting all three recommendations, meeting none, one, and two recommendations were associated with a higher BMI z-score, waist circumference, and behavioral strengths and difficulties score and lower aerobic fitness in a gradient pattern (Ptrend<0.05). Additionally, compared to meeting all three recommendations, meeting none and one recommendation were associated with higher systolic blood pressure and insulin (Ptrend<0.05). Finally, compared to meeting all three recommendations, meeting no recommendations was associated with higher triglycerides and lower HDL-cholesterol (Ptrend<0.05). Collectively, meeting more recommendations within the 24-hour movement guidelines was associated with better overall health. Since a small proportion (17%) of this representative sample was meeting the overall guidelines, efforts to promote adoption are needed.

Abstract
BACKGROUND/AIMS Conservative management of traumatic epidural hematomas is being recognized as a safe alternative to surgical treatment in asymptomatic children. There is still debate about the maximal size of epidural hematoma that should be tolerated before deciding for surgery. METHODS We report - through a retrospective cohort study from a single institution - a series of 16 conservatively managed traumatic epidural hematomas of more than 15 mm thickness. RESULTS 14 patients (88%) were successfully treated using conservative management. Two patients required surgery. These 2 patients had the only 2 documented high-velocity injury mechanisms. All patients had a Glasgow Outcome Scale of 5/5 on follow-up. CONCLUSION Conservative management with close observation is a safe alternative even in this population of voluminous hematomas. Injury velocity may be a contributing factor for failure of conservative management in this population.

Abstract
BACKGROUND This retrospective study aimed to characterize and analyze the outcome of therapy-related myeloid neoplasms (t-MNs) in children and adolescents. METHODS The medical records of 16 patients under 21 years of age at the time of t-MN diagnosis were reviewed. RESULTS The median patient age was 11.5 years (range, 1.6-20.4 yr). Twelve patients had therapy-related acute myeloid leukemia, 3 patients had myelodysplastic syndrome, and 1 patient had chronic myelomonocytic leukemia. The median latency period was 29 months (range, 11-68 mo). Fourteen patients had cytogenetic aberrations, 8 of whom had an 11q23 abnormality. Of the 13 patients treated with curative intent, 12 patients received myeloid-type induction therapy that led to complete remission (CR) in 8 patients. Nine patients underwent allogeneic transplantation; 4 patients did not undergo transplantation due to chemotherapy-related toxic death (N=3) or parental refusal (N=1). The 5-year overall survival and event-free survival of the 13 patients treated with a curative intent were 46.2% and 30.8%, respectively. For the 9 patients who underwent allogeneic transplantation, the 5-year event-free survival was 66.7%. CONCLUSION A significant proportion of young patients with t-MNs can experience long-term survival, and allogeneic transplantation plays a key role for attaining cure in these patients.

Abstract
The use of general (face-mask inhalation and intravenous) anesthesia has been the method of choice for tympanostomy tube insertion in children. However, there is no exact guideline for the choice of anesthesia method and there is no evidence to support the use of one anesthesia method over another. Clinically, the anesthesia method used to be decided by old customs and the surgeon's blind faith that children cannot bear tympanostomy tube insertion under local anesthesia. Clinicians should keep in mind that pediatric anesthesia has a potential risk. Despite infrequent serious complications, their seriousness necessitates that sedation or general anesthesia should be done by an anesthesiologist and thus children requiring tympanostomy tube insertion should be referred to secondary or tertiary hospitals, even if they have been followed by a primary care physician for a long time. Previous evidence showed that local anesthesia is appropriate for tympanostomy tube insertion in selected children, especially in children older than 5 years are older. Proper choice of anesthesia method is helpful for both patient and medical service provider. Local anesthesia can give psychological relief to children and their parent. It is easier for the medical service providers to schedule the operation and allocate the medical resources in their hospital. Local anesthesia can reduce individual, social, and national burdens for the health care services.

Abstract
Crohn's disease (CD) is an autoimmune inflammatory disorder that primarily affects the gastrointestinal tract. It may have pulmonary involvement, which has been rarely reported in pediatric patients. Down syndrome (DS) has been associated with increased frequency of autoimmune diseases. However, associations between CD and DS have been rarely reported. We present the case of a 5-year-old girl with known DS and a history of chronic intermittent abdominal pain who presented with persistent pneumonia. Her workup included a chest computed tomography (CT) scan that showed multiple noncalcified pulmonary nodules. An extensive infectious workup was done that was negative. CT-guided needle biopsy of the lung nodules showed necrotizing granulomas. This raised concern for primary CD with extraintestinal pulmonary manifestation. An esophagogastroduodenoscopy and colonoscopy were performed, and colon biopsies showed scattered epithelioid granulomas. Based on this information, there was consensus that her lung nodules were secondary to CD. She was started on standard therapy for CD, and her abdominal and respiratory symptoms gradually improved. However, she continues to have mild residual lung calcification and fibrosis. To our knowledge, this is the first reported case of pulmonary CD in a child with DS. The natural history of pulmonary CD in the pediatric population is not very well studied. Furthermore, since DS has been well known to be associated with increased frequency of malignancies and autoimmune conditions due to immune dysregulation, it is difficult to predict the severity and possible complications in this patient.

Abstract
Takotsubo syndrome (TTS) is an acquired transient type of systolic dysfunction which mimics myocardial infarction clinically and electrocardiographically. TTS is also known as stress cardiomyopathy, broken heart syndrome, apical ballooning, reversible acute heart failure, neurogenic stunned myocardium or acute catecholamine cardiomyopathy. This case report describes an uncommon presentation of myocardial stunning after an anesthetic procedure. A 14-year-old girl with a history of pineal cyst and hemiplegic migraine was admitted for control brain magnetic resonance imaging. During anesthesia induction with propofol she suffered bradycardia, which was reversed with atropine, followed by tachyarrhythmia, reversed with lidocaine and precordial thump. Within hours she developed pulmonary edema and global respiratory failure due to acute left ventricular dysfunction. A transthoracic echocardiogram showed a dilated left ventricle with global hypokinesia and depressed left ventricular systolic function (ejection fraction <30%). The electrocardiogram showed persistent sinus tachycardia and nonspecific ST-T wave abnormalities. Cardiac biomarkers were elevated (troponin 2.42 ng/ml, proBNP 8248 pg/ml). She was placed on diuretics, angiotensin-converting enzyme inhibitors, digoxin and dopamine. The clinical course was satisfactory with clinical, biochemical and echocardiographic improvement within four days. Subsequent echocardiograms showed no ventricular dysfunction. The patient was discharged home on carvedilol, which was discontinued after normalization of cardiac function on cardiac magnetic resonance imaging. Few cases of TTS have been described in children, some of them triggered by acute central nervous system disorders and others not fulfilling all the classical diagnostic criteria. In this case the anesthetic procedure probably triggered the TTS.

Abstract
The volumetric quantification of brain structures is of great interest in pediatric populations because it allows the investigation of different factors influencing neurodevelopment. FreeSurfer and FSL both provide frequently used packages for automatic segmentation of brain structures. In this study, we examined the accuracy and consistency of those two automated protocols relative to manual segmentation, commonly considered as the "gold standard" technique, for estimating hippocampus and amygdala volumes in a sample of preadolescent children aged between 6 to 11 years. The volumes obtained with FreeSurfer and FSL-FIRST were evaluated and compared with manual segmentations with respect to volume difference, spatial agreement and between- and within-method correlations. Results highlighted a tendency for both automated techniques to overestimate hippocampus and amygdala volumes, in comparison to manual segmentation. This was more pronounced when using FreeSurfer than FSL-FIRST and, for both techniques, the overestimation was more marked for the amygdala than the hippocampus. Pearson correlations support moderate associations between manual tracing and FreeSurfer for hippocampus (right r=0.69, p<0.001; left r=0.77, p<0.001) and amygdala (right r=0.61, p<0.001; left r=0.67, p<0.001) volumes. Correlation coefficients between manual segmentation and FSL-FIRST were statistically significant (right hippocampus r=0.59, p<0.001; left hippocampus r=0.51, p<0.001; right amygdala r=0.35, p<0.001; left amygdala r=0.31, p<0.001) but were significantly weaker, for all investigated structures. When computing intraclass correlation coefficients between manual tracing and automatic segmentation, all comparisons, except for left hippocampus volume estimated with FreeSurfer, failed to reach 0.70. When looking at each method separately, correlations between left and right hemispheric volumes showed strong associations between bilateral hippocampus and bilateral amygdala volumes when assessed using manual segmentation or FreeSurfer. These correlations were significantly weaker when volumes were assessed with FSL-FIRST. Finally, Bland-Altman plots suggest that the difference between manual and automatic segmentation might be influenced by the volume of the structure, because smaller volumes were associated with larger volume differences between techniques. These results demonstrate that, at least in a pediatric population, the agreement between amygdala and hippocampus volumes obtained with automated FSL-FIRST and FreeSurfer protocols and those obtained with manual segmentation is not strong. Visual inspection by an informed individual and, if necessary, manual correction of automated segmentation outputs are important to ensure validity of volumetric results and interpretation of related findings.

Abstract
BACKGROUND AND OBJECTIVES To evaluate the relationship between age and anesthesia method used for tympanostomy tube insertion (TTI) and to provide evidence to guide the selection of an appropriate anesthesia method in children. SUBJECTS AND METHODS We performed a retrospective review of children under 15 years of age who underwent tympanostomy tube insertion (n=159) or myringotomy alone (n=175) under local or general anesthesia by a single surgeon at a university-based, secondary care referral hospital. Epidermiologic data between local and general anesthesia groups as well as between TTI and myringotomy were analyzed. Medical costs were compared between local and general anesthesia groups. RESULTS Children who received local anesthesia were significantly older than those who received general anesthesia. Unilateral tympanostomy tube insertion was performed more frequently under local anesthesia than bilateral. Logistic regression modeling showed that local anesthesia was more frequently applied in older children (odds ratio=1.041) and for unilateral tympanostomy tube insertion (odds ratio=8.990). The cut-off value of age for local anesthesia was roughly 5 years. CONCLUSIONS In a pediatric population at a single medical center, age and whether unilateral or bilateral procedures were required were important factors in selecting an anesthesia method for tympanostomy tube insertion. Our findings suggest that local anesthesia can be preferentially considered for children 5 years of age or older, especially in those with unilateral otitis media with effusion.

Abstract
OBJECTIVE To examine the effectiveness of posterior tibial nerve stimulation (PTNS) for the treatment of fecal and urinary incontinence in children with malformations of the bowel or neurological pathologies. INTRODUCTION Treatment of fecal and urinary leaks, in cases of congenital malformations remains a challenge. Recent studies in adults have shown the effectiveness of PTNS. METHOD Eight children: 4 with anorectal malformations, 3 with neurological causes (1 medullary lipoma, 1 Arnold Chiari malformation, 1 sacrococcygeal teratoma) and 1 with Hirschsprung's disease presenting with serious anal incontinence, despite extensive bowel management during at least 2 years, were treated with PTNS. Six children had associated urinary leaks. Jorge-Wexner score for defecation and Schurch score for urine were used before treatment and after the second and sixth months of stimulation. RESULTS After six months, five patients had no more fecal leakage, two patients were improved and one did not respond. Five out of the 6 patients with urinary leaks were continent at 6 months. CONCLUSION PTNS is a noninvasive technique and painless modality which seems to be effective for the treatment of fecal and urinary leaks in children even with congenital digestive pathologies or neurological malformations. These results will be confirmed in a prospective study.

Abstract
OBJECTIVES This study presents the successful posterior surgical reduction and fusion on a 26-month-old child with chronic unilateral locked facet joint and spinal cord injury (SCI). METHODS A 26-month-old child with chronic unilateral locked facet joint and SCI treated by posterior surgical reduction and fusion. Plaster external fixation was applied and rehabilitation exercise was trained post-operatively. RESULTS Chronic unilateral locked facet joint was reduced successfully and bone fusion of C4/5 was achieved 3 months after surgery. The function of both lower limbs was improved 1 year after surgery, aided with physical rehabilitation. CONCLUSION Unilateral locked facet joint in pediatric population is rare. Few clinical experiences were found in the literature. Non-surgical treatment has advantages of not being invasive and is preferred for acute patients; however, it may not be suitable for chronic unilateral locked facet joint with SCI, in which surgical intervention is needed.

Abstract
OBJECTIVE Establishing the prevalence of semicircular canal dehiscence in a pediatric population using temporal bone CT imaging. STUDY DESIGN Retrospective analysis of all temporal bone CT scans during a 5-year period (2007-2012). METHODS CT scan images were reformatted in the plane of the canals and assessed by two independent reviewers with a third to resolve disagreement. Detailed chart review was performed for those found to have dehiscence. Superior and posterior canals were classified as "dehiscent", "possibly dehiscent", "thin" or "normal" for each case. RESULTS 649 temporal bones were assessed from 334 children (under 18 years of age). The prevalence rate of superior canal dehiscence (SCD) was 1.7% (3.3% of individuals). Posterior canal dehiscence (PCD) was present in 1.2% (2.1% of individuals). There were no cases of bilateral SCD, and one case of bilateral PCD. Age under 3 years was associated with a higher prevalence of thinning but not dehiscence. Congenital inner ear malformation was not related to a higher probability of dehiscence. The superior petrosal sinus was associated with the SCD in three cases (27.3%). Retrospective chart review highlighted possible vestibular symptoms in 3/11 patients with SCD (27.3%). CONCLUSIONS This forms the largest pediatric study of canal dehiscence to date. This study's prevalence rate is significantly lower than previous reports. The identified association with overlying venous structures may reflect the etiological process involved. The occurrence in children supports the hypothesis of a congenital predisposition for development of canal dehiscence syndrome.

Abstract
BACKGROUND CONTEXT Instability of the atlantoaxial spine is a recognized problem in children. Safe passage of pedicle screws at C2 poses challenges because of the proximity to the vertebral artery, size of the pedicles, and variations in the location of the foramen transversarium. PURPOSE The C2 translaminar technique is a useful option and its stability is comparable to that offered by C2 pedicle screws. In this follow-up from our previously published study, we wanted to verify the safety and suitability of the C2 laminar screw in the treatment of cervical instability in the pediatric population. STUDY DESIGN/SETTING We present a case series of eight pediatric patients who underwent laminar screw fixation of the axis as part of their operative procedure. PATIENT SAMPLE There were five girls and three boys, with a mean age of 7 years (range 2-17 years) who underwent this procedure. Surgical indications included atlantoaxial instability, atlanto-occipital disassociation, multilevel cervical instability, and high cervical stenosis. Seven patients had underlying dysplastic syndromes. OUTCOME MEASURES We studied the technical feasibility of passing laminar screws at C2 in eight consecutive patients, paying attention to screw length and diameter, vascular or neurologic complications, and stability of fixation. METHODS This retrospective study was funded by our institution and there was no potential conflict of interest. All patients were placed prone. The posterior aspect of the cervical spine and craniocervical junction were exposed subperiosteally. We report our modification of the Wright technique, which allowed us to safely pass 3.5-mm screws into both laminae of the second cervical vertebra. RESULTS A total of 15 laminar screws were passed at C2. The follow-up period ranged from 1 to 24 months (mean 8 months). There were no vascular or neurologic complications, no infection, and no instances of hardware failure either by lamina fracture or screw pullout. All patients maintained stable constructs on imaging studies at the last follow-up evaluation. CONCLUSION Children as young as 2 years can undergo safe and rigid fixation of the axis. The technique is especially valuable in patients with dysplastic bone and distorted anatomy where more traditional methods of C2 fixation cannot be safely used. To our knowledge, this is the largest reported series of C2 laminar screw fixation in a pediatric population.

Abstract
OBJECTIVE To evaluate the anatomical feasibility of 3.5 mm screw into the cervical spine in the pediatric population and to establish useful guidelines for their placement. METHODS A total of 37 cervical spine computerized tomography scans (24 boys and 13 girls) were included in this study. All patients were younger than 10 years of age at the time of evaluation for the period of 2007-2011. RESULTS For the C1 screw placement, entry point height (EPH) was the most restrictive factor (47.3% patients were larger than 3.5 mm). All C2 lamina had a height larger than 3.5 mm and 68.8% (51/74) of C2 lamina had a width thicker than 3.5 mm. For C2 pedicle width, 55.4% (41/74) of cases were larger than 3.5 mm, while 58.1% (43/74) of pedicle heights were larger than 3.5 mm. For pedicle width of subaxial spine, 75.7% (C3), 73% (C4), 82.4% (C5), 89.2% (C6), and 98.1% (C7, 1/54) were greater than 3.5 mm. Mean lamina width of subaxial cervical spine was 3.1 (C3), 2.7 (C4), 2.9 (C5), 3.8 (C6), and 4.0 mm (C7), respectively. Only 34.6% (127/370) of subaxial (C3-7) lamina thickness were greater than 3.5 mm. Mean length of lateral mass for the lateral mass screw placement was 9.28 (C3), 9.08 (C4), 8.81 (C5), 8.98 (C6), and 10.38 mm (C7). CONCLUSION C1 lateral mass fixation could be limited by the morphometrics of lateral mass height. C2 trans-lamina approach is preferable to C2 pedicle screw fixation. In subaxial spines, pedicle screw placement was preferable to trans-lamina screw placement, except at C7.

Abstract
Type 1 Diabetes Mellitus (T1DM) is a widespread chronic disease among children and adolescents. Diagnosis and evolution usually involves a significant burden on the patient, and their families must change various aspects of their lifestyle to fulfill the demands of treatment. This study aims to identify the main psychological, family, and adjustment to illness features of children and adolescents diagnosed with DM1 and, in particular to highlight the associated psychopathological factors. The methodology involved a systematic literature search in the main scientific databases. Due to the biopsychosocial impact of DM1 usually assumed in the life of the child and family, and how it may compromise the quality of life and emotional well-being of both, different studies have agreed on the importance of identifying the set of psychological factors involved in healthy adjustment to illness in the child and adolescent with DM1.

Abstract
Therapeutic plasma apheresis or exchange (TPE) in the pediatric population is technically challenging. Moreover, there is generally an apprehension in using TPE in children compared to adults. Recently, usage of TPE has evolved and is now being used in heterogenous clinical conditions. Its usefulness is classified by the American Society for Apheresis (ASFA) into various categories ranging from I to IV. The objective of this paper was to review the procedure in context of clinical indications, complications and outcomes in children. For this purpose, we retrospectively reviewed all TPE procedures performed on inpatients of 3 to 16 years of age during a 6-year period (2007-2012). A total of 130 procedures were performed on 28 patients (M : F ratio of 1:1) with median age (range) of 8.8 (4-16) years. All procedures were done using the continuous cell-separator centrifugal method. Due to organ dysfunctions, the majority of procedures (N = 26 of 28 or 92% patients) were performed in the pediatric intensive care unit. Twenty-three, four and one patient belonged to ASFA categories I, II and III, respectively. The most common indications were neurological disorders (N = 13 or 46.4%), comprised of Guillain-Barré syndrome (N = 10) and myasthenia gravis (N = 3). Hematological disorders (N = 10 or 35.7%) including thrombotic thrombocytopenic purpura-hemolytic uremic syndrome were a close second. Complete recovery was seen in 23 patients (84%). Trivial adverse effects were observed in 18/130 (13.8%) procedures. Major complications including cardiac arrest, hypotension and transfusion-related acute lung injury were observed in 5/130 or 3.8% of procedures. However, there was no procedure-related death though five patients died during treatment due to underlying pathology. In conclusion, TPE is a safe and effective option in sick children for appropriate indications. An experienced staff with sound procedural skills is imperative for successful therapy.

Abstract
INTRODUCTION Influenza vaccination is recommended in Catalonia in children older than 6 months with risk conditions for developing flu-related complications. The aim of this study is to determine influenza vaccine coverage in children with risk conditions and their association with socio-demographic factors and medical variables. MATERIAL AND METHOD Descriptive cross-sectional study of children with risk conditions for developing influenza complications (aged between 6months and 15years old) assigned to Primary Health Care centers in Catalonia at the beginning of the 2011-2012 influenza vaccination campaign. The information on vaccination status and study variables were obtained from data registered on electronic health records by primary care teams. The relationship between influenza vaccination and demographic and medical variables was analyzed using bivariate analysis and a multiple logistic regression model. RESULTS Influenza vaccination coverage was 23.9%. Variables associated with influenza vaccination were: age 2years or older (aOR: 1.6 [1.4-1.7] in children 3-5years old; 1.8 [1.7-2.0] in those 6-10 years, and 2.2 [2.0 -2.4] in children ≥11years]); male sex (aOR: 1.1 [1.0-1.1]); foreign nationality (aOR: 1.2 [1.2-1.3]); age-appropriate immunization according to the systematic immunization schedule (aOR: 3.3 [2.8-3.8]); more than one visit to the primary care physician (5 or more visits) (aOR: 4.1 [3.8-4.4]), and more than one risk condition (3 or more conditions) (aOR: 2.5 [1.6-3.9]). DISCUSSION Compared to other countries, influenza vaccination coverage among children with risk conditions is low in our study. Strategies to improve coverage should be implemented.

Abstract
The incidence of stone disease has been increasing and the risk of recurrent stone formation is high in a pediatric population. It is crucial to use the most effective method with the primary goal of complete stone removal to prevent recurrence from residual fragments. While extracorporeal shock wave lithotripsy (ESWL) is still considered first line therapy in many clinics for urinary tract stones in children, endoscopic techniques are widely preferred due to miniaturization of instruments and evolution of surgical techniques. The standard procedures to treat urinary stone disease in children are the same as those used in an adult population. These include ESWL, ureterorenoscopy, percutaneous nephrolithotomy (standard PCNL or mini-perc), laparoscopic and open surgery. ESWL is currently the procedure of choice for treating most upper urinary tract calculi in a pediatric population. In recent years, endourological management of pediatric urinary stone disease is preferred in many centers with increasing experience in endourological techniques and decreasing sizes of surgical equipment. The management of pediatric stone disease has evolved with improvements in the technique and a decrease in the size of surgical instruments. Recently, endoscopic methods have been safely and effectively used in children with minor complications. In this review, we aim to summarize the recent management of urolithiasis in children.

Abstract
OBJECTIVE Recent evidence suggests that short bouts of uninterrupted sedentary behavior reduce insulin sensitivity and glucose tolerance while increasing triglyceride levels in both healthy and overweight/obese adults. To date no study has examined the acute impact of uninterrupted sitting in children and youth. The objective of the present study was to determine whether 8 h of uninterrupted sitting increases markers of cardiometabolic disease risk in healthy children and youth, in comparison to 8 h of sitting interrupted by light intensity walk breaks or structured physical activity. MATERIALS/METHODS 11 healthy males and 8 healthy females between the ages of 10 and 14 years experienced 3 conditions in random order: (1) 8 h of uninterrupted sitting (Sedentary); (2) 8 h of sitting interrupted with a 2-min light-intensity walk break every 20 min (Breaks); and (3) 8 h of sitting interrupted with a 2-min light-intensity walk break every 20 min as well as 2×20 min of moderate-intensity physical activity (Breaks+Physical Activity). Insulin, glucose, triglyceride, HDL and LDL cholesterol area under the curve were calculated for each condition. RESULTS We observed no significant differences in the area under the curve for any marker of cardiometabolic disease risk across the 3 study conditions (all p>0.09). CONCLUSIONS These results suggest that in comparison to interrupted sitting or structured physical activity, a single bout of 8 h of uninterrupted sitting does not result in measurable changes in circulating levels of insulin, glucose, or lipids in healthy children and youth.
